WR53 PCZ is a 2003 Fiat Scudo in White with a 1,868c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 20 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 55%.
Across all 2003 Fiat Scudo models, the average MOT pass rate is 68.5% with a typical mileage of 88,307 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Fiat Scudo f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 25,288 recorded failures. If you're considering buying WR53 PCZ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Fiat Scudo typ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 23 years old, this Fiat Scudo is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
